NORTHEAST KANSAS (KSNT) – This week’s episode of K-Nation focuses on Kansas’ loss in the second round of the NCAA Tournament and the formal introduction of new K-State men’s basketball head coach Casey Alexander. Plus, an exclusive one-on-one with NCAA Triple Jump National Champion Daniela Wamokpego.
- The No. 4-seed Kansas Jayhawks fell just short against No. 5-seed St. John’s in round two of the NCAA Tournament, 67-65, thanks to a last-second buzzer beater
- New K-State men’s basketball head coach Casey Alexander was formally introduced on March 16
- K-State women’s basketball is bounced from the WBIT Tournament in round two, following a 83-75 loss to California
- Kansas women’s hoops advances to the WBIT Quarterfinals on March 26 following a 62-55 victory over Rice
- Kansas baseball grabbed a 10-0 run-rule win over Mizzou in the Buck O’Neil Classic Wednesday, before sweeping Houston in a weekend series
- KU softball grabbed a series win over Utah with a 10-5 win in Sunday’s rubbermatch
- Despite a 12-1 win over Arizona State Sunday, the Wildcats dropped the conference series 2-1
- K-Nation’s Sydney Clark sat down with K-State National Champion triple jumper Daniela Wamokpego in an exclusive one-on-one interview
